Design and Manufacturing of a Fully Digital Palatal Expander Without Physical Models

Dr. Battista and colleagues describe a fully digital workflow for computer-aided fabrication of a rapid palatal expander. Steps include design of the anchorage structure, placement of a virtual attachment, positioning of the expansion screw, addition of auxiliaries, 3D printing by the laboratory, and delivery to the patient.
